JONESBOROUGH – Washington County Sheriff’s Deputies arrested Jimmie Crumley, 48, of Fall Branch, and charged him with aggravated assault – domestic.

According to Sheriff Keith Sexton, the incident occurred the afternoon of Aug. 2 in Fall Branch. Crumley and another individual were arguing outside the home when a juvenile came outside. During the confrontation, Crumley pointed a handgun at the juvenile and then struck him in the head with the gun. The other adult took the handgun away from Crumley, who then fled the scene in a vehicle belonging to the homeowner.

When deputies arrived, they located Crumley hiding behind a garage approximately a mile away from the scene. He was taken into custody without incident.

Crumley is being held in the Washington County Detention Center on a $10,000 bond. He was scheduled to appear in court on Aug. 3.
